You Searched For: 3-Chloro-6-piperidin-1-ylpyridazine


2  results were found

Sort Results

List View Easy View
SearchResultCount:"2"
Description: 1-(2-Fluoropyridin-3-yl)ethanol ≥95%
Catalog Number: 76885-670
Supplier: AOBChem USA


385 - 2 of 2